    pgrok

    pgrok

    HTTP/TCP reverse tunnel solution through SSH remote port forwarding

    The pgrok is a multi-tenant HTTP/TCP reverse tunnel solution through remote port forwarding from the SSH protocol. This is intended for small teams that need to expose the local development environment to the public internet, and you need to bring your own domain name and SSO provider. It gives a stable subdomain for every user and gated by your SSO through the OIDC protocol. Think of this as a bare-bones alternative to the ngrok's $65/user/month enterprise tier.

    SMTP Tunnel Proxy

    SMTP Tunnel Proxy

    A high-speed covert tunnel that disguises TCP traffic as SMTP email

    SMTP Tunnel Proxy is a high-speed covert tunneling proxy that disguises regular TCP traffic as legitimate SMTP email communication to evade deep packet inspection (DPI) firewalls and censorship systems. It implements a SOCKS5 proxy interface on the client that wraps outbound traffic into an SMTP-like handshake (EHLO, STARTTLS, AUTH) and encrypted payload, making the session appear to DPI systems as a normal email exchange.     http-proxy-tunnel

    Create nested tunnels through HTTP proxies

    Http-proxy-tunnel creates TCP tunnels through http proxies that permit the CONNECT method. It differs from other proxy tunnelling programs in that it can tunnel through multiple proxies, and can use SSL tunnels. These abilities mean that in combination with a web server that can proxy (such as Apache) you can serve normal web pages from ports 80 and 443 and connect to the server (using ssh say) via those ports at the same time.

    Chisel

    Chisel

    A fast TCP/UDP tunnel over HTTP

    Chisel is a lightweight tunneling tool designed to move TCP and UDP traffic through HTTP while securing the connection with SSH. It packages both client and server functionality into a single Go-based executable, which makes it practical for fast deployment across different environments. The project is especially useful when direct network access is restricted but HTTP or HTTPS traffic is still allowed.
